1/ Linport Report by Arle Lommel
Linport started in Danvres, MA [last LISA event]
Focus: Project metadata, Translation Guidance specification, IATF like work model
Participants: Ltac – Alan Melby’s not for profit hosts it, GALA, Alan’s Research Group
(E)DGT – merged their efforts with the Danvers group
Open for anyone - Linport.org – Instructions how to join

2/ Relationship with LISA OSCAR successor standards
Arle and David report: Patrick says that the only way is join on behalf of employer.
This person can be later designated as XLIFF liaison, but still be bound with ETSI confidentiality.
Bryan will inquire with Tektronix if he can join ISG LIS
AI Bryan: Inquire with Tektronix
Arle: ETSI have a good IPR model, they ask at the start of each meeting if anyone has IPR to disclose.
Next meeting in November, probably
Bryan to inform the SC if he was able to join on behalf of Tectronics. If this proves possible David will submit it as XLIFF TC agenda point.
Arle: GALA also hosts the LISA standards under Creative Commons, Attribution 3.0
Arle: I agree that FRAND is dangerous, problematic,
Patents must be declared upfront
Arle: No way to have different official IPR Trying to push an informal policy
MOU between ETSI and OASIS. Arle to report more on the MOU
